【技术实现步骤摘要】
一种通信方法、装置、设备及介质
本专利技术涉及网络通信
,尤其涉及一种通信方法、装置、设备及介质。
技术介绍
现有智能电视在与其他设备在应用层中进行通信时,可以通过超文本传输协议(HyperTextTransferProtocol,HTTP)进行互联网控制报文协议(InternetControlMessageProtocol,ICMP)数据包的发送与应答,但在应用层直接传输ICMP数据包很容易被黑客设备拦截,使得智能电视在与其他设备进行通信的安全性得不到保证。为了应对当前互联网中复杂的网络环境,以及各种黑客注入技术,目前智能电视作为智能终端在与其他设备进行通信时,安全性方面全部依赖于动态主机配置协议(DynamicHostConfigurationProtocol,DHCP)服务器,该DHCP服务器在局域网中一般为路由器,即网关。目前常见的家庭局域网中,智能电视通过有线或者无线连接的方式与网关进行连接,以期可以通过网关来保证智能电视在与其他设备进行通信时的安全性。但是由于黑客技术快速革新,如果局域网网关 ...
【技术保护点】
1.一种通信方法,其特征在于,所述方法包括:/n接收其他设备发送的第一ARP信息,获取所述第一ARP信息中携带的发送所述第一ARP信息的第一目标设备的第一IP地址及第一MAC地址;/n根据所述第一IP地址及第一MAC地址与智能电视本地保存的ARP静态表中的IP地址及MAC地址的对应关系是否一致,确定所述第一目标设备的目标MAC地址;其中,所述ARP静态表中的IP地址及MAC地址的对应关系与网关中保存的IP地址及MAC地址的对应关系一致,所述网关与所述智能电视位于同一局域网内;/n向所述目标MAC地址的第一目标设备发送相应的响应信息。/n
【技术特征摘要】
1.一种通信方法,其特征在于,所述方法包括:
接收其他设备发送的第一ARP信息,获取所述第一ARP信息中携带的发送所述第一ARP信息的第一目标设备的第一IP地址及第一MAC地址;
根据所述第一IP地址及第一MAC地址与智能电视本地保存的ARP静态表中的IP地址及MAC地址的对应关系是否一致,确定所述第一目标设备的目标MAC地址;其中,所述ARP静态表中的IP地址及MAC地址的对应关系与网关中保存的IP地址及MAC地址的对应关系一致,所述网关与所述智能电视位于同一局域网内;
向所述目标MAC地址的第一目标设备发送相应的响应信息。
2.根据权利要求1所述的方法,其特征在于,所述获取所述第一ARP信息中携带第一目标设备的第一IP地址及第一MAC地址之后,根据所述第一IP地址及第一MAC地址与所述智能电视本地保存的ARP静态表中的IP地址及MAC地址的对应关系是否一致,确定所述第一目标设备的目标MAC地址之前,所述方法还包括:
将所述第一IP地址及所述第一MAC地址的第一对应关系保存在ARP缓存表中;
所述根据所述第一IP地址及第一MAC地址与所述智能电视本地保存的ARP静态表中的IP地址及MAC地址的对应关系是否一致,确定所述第一目标设备的目标MAC地址,包括:
针对所述第一对应关系,判断所述ARP静态表中的IP地址及MAC地址的对应关系中是否存在所述第一对应关系;
若存在,将所述第一MAC地址确定为目标MAC地址;
若不存在,将所述ARP静态表中的所述第一IP地址对应的第二MAC地址确定为目标MAC地址。
3.根据权利要求2所述的方法,其特征在于,所述若所述ARP静态表中的IP地址及MAC地址的对应关系中不存在所述第一对应关系,所述方法还包括:
将所述ARP缓存表中的所述第一对应关系更新为所述第一IP地址及所述第二MAC地址的第二对应关系。
4.根据权利要求1所述的方法,其特征在于,所述ARP静态表中的IP地址及MAC地址的对应关系的获取过程包括:
在当前时间满足预设的更新条件时,从网关的管理网站中获取与所述智能电视位于同一局域网内的网关保存的IP地址及MAC地址的对应关系;
将获取的所述IP地址及MAC地址的对应关系保存在所述ARP静态表中。
5.根据权利要求1所述的方法,其特...
【专利技术属性】
技术研发人员:蒋军禄,刘晓东,张足刚,
申请(专利权)人:海信视像科技股份有限公司,
类型:发明
国别省市:山东;37
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。